扣子怎么写入飞书多维表格
时间: 2025-06-11 09:54:47 浏览: 52
<think>好的,我现在需要帮助用户了解如何通过API或集成方式向飞书多维表格写入数据。首先,我需要回忆用户提供的引用内容,看看里面有没有相关的信息。
根据引用[1],飞书开放平台提供了操作多维表格的API,应用程序可以通过这些API进行数据处理。引用[3]提到可以通过API创建多维表格,或者使用模板复制数据,避免每次调整格式。此外,引用[3]还提到了参考官方文档,比如创建多维表格和复制模板的步骤。
接下来,我应该整理这些信息,分步骤说明如何写入数据。首先可能需要创建应用并获取权限,然后获取多维表格的ID,再调用具体的API接口来添加记录。此外,用户可能需要示例代码,比如使用Python或Java来演示如何发送请求。
需要注意用户提到的系统级指令,比如行内公式用$...$,独立公式用$$...$$,但这个问题可能不涉及数学公式,所以可能不需要处理这部分。另外,要生成相关问题,比如关于身份验证、字段映射或批量操作的问题。
需要确保回答结构清晰,分步骤讲解,同时引用正确的来源。比如在步骤中提到获取App ID和App Secret时,可以引用[1]和[3],因为这些步骤通常属于应用创建和权限配置部分。
可能还需要检查是否有遗漏的步骤,比如事件订阅机制,但根据用户的问题,主要关注的是写入数据,而不是订阅变更,所以引用[2]可能暂时不需要,但可以作为相关问题提到。
最后,生成的相关问题应该围绕用户可能进一步想知道的内容,比如如何验证身份、处理字段映射或批量操作,这些都与数据写入流程相关。</think>### 如何通过API或集成方式向飞书多维表格写入数据?
向飞书多维表格写入数据需通过飞书开放平台的API实现,以下是具体操作步骤:
---
#### **1. 创建应用并配置权限**
- **创建企业自建应用**:在飞书开放平台后台创建应用,获取`App ID`和`App Secret`[^1][^3]。
- **配置权限**:为应用添加以下权限:
- **多维表格**:`多维表格数据增删改查`、`管理多维表格`。
- **文件**:`访问应用自有资源`(若需操作文件模板)。
---
#### **2. 获取多维表格信息**
- **多维表格ID**:在飞书多维表格界面中,通过URL获取表格ID(形如`tblxxxxxxxx`)。
- **字段映射**:记录表格中每个字段的`字段ID`和类型(如文本、数字等),用于后续API请求的格式匹配。
---
#### **3. 调用API写入数据**
飞书多维表格提供`添加记录`接口,具体请求示例如下:
```python
# 示例:Python调用飞书API添加记录
import requests
url = "https://open.feishu.cn/open-apis/bitable/v1/apps/{app_token}/tables/{table_id}/records"
headers = {
"Authorization": "Bearer {access_token}",
"Content-Type": "application/json"
}
data = {
"fields": {
"字段ID1": "值1",
"字段ID2": 100,
"字段ID3": ["选项1", "选项2"] # 多选类型字段示例
}
}
response = requests.post(url, headers=headers, json=data)
```
- **关键参数说明**:
- `app_token`:多维表格的唯一标识符。
- `access_token`:通过`App ID`和`App Secret`获取的访问令牌。
- `fields`:需与多维表格字段类型严格匹配,否则写入失败。
---
#### **4. 使用模板简化流程(可选)**
- **预定义模板**:在飞书多维表格中创建数据模板,通过API复制模板生成新表格,避免手动配置字段格式。
- **API调用示例**:
```text
POST /open-apis/bitable/v1/apps/{app_token}/tables/{table_id}/copy
```
---
#### **5. 集成到微服务项目**
- **Spring Boot集成示例**:通过`FeignClient`或`RestTemplate`封装API请求,结合飞书的事件订阅机制监听数据变更[^2]。
- **安全性**:建议将`App Secret`和`access_token`存储在配置中心或环境变量中,避免硬编码。
---
阅读全文
相关推荐


















